Review current rules for zoos and their suitability for the future

Petition Details

As a consequence of the Corona Virus pandemic we have had our personal liberty severely, but only temporarily, restricted. Few if any people can be finding this experience enjoyable.

Animals kept in zoos have their liberty removed completely, and in most cases permanently.

Additional Information

Now that we have a better understanding of how restrictions on our liberty feel, we should review the case for zoos. If they serve an essential purpose other than simply our entertainment, then we should establish legal minimum standards for the conditions in which animals can be kept.
